Handrail Materials: A Complete Overview

Selecting the right banister material is crucial for both protection and aesthetics in any structure . Many choices are present, each possessing special attributes in terms of longevity, cost , and visual appeal . Frequently used handrail substances include wood , alloy, silicate, and composites .

  • Wood: Offers a inviting ambiance and can be finished to match any style. Yet , it requires regular maintenance .
  • Metal: Provides outstanding toughness and durability . Common metal kinds are steel and iron.
  • Glass: Creates a contemporary and unobstructed feel . It’s frequently used in combination with alloy frames .
  • Composites: Offer a blend of benefits , combining the appearance of lumber with the low care of plastics .
Finally, the optimal handrail material depends on your individual requirements and resources.

Railing Safety: Building Regulations & Recommended Practices

Ensuring safe handrails is vital for preventing falls and preserving property safety . Applicable structural regulations , such as the Local Residential Standard , specify minimum clearances, usable sizes , and spacing between balusters . Proper practices also consider materials that are durable , unaffected to decay, and deliver a textured surface to lessen the probability of incidents . Regular evaluations and prompt repairs are crucial to maintain continued function .
